- [ ] Issue the new starter their spare-hardware kit from Room B14 (the cage next to the loading bay, Harwick Building). Stock: monitors, docks, keyboards, loaner laptops. Log every item taken on the clipboard sheet inside the door — no exceptions. The cage stays locked at all times; do not prop it open while picking. The keypad by the handle unlocks the cage, and facilities staff should use the door code below.

door code, yagap-bahof: bdg-O-05

## Formula sandbox tuning

User-supplied formulas in Gridmoor execute inside a restricted interpreter with hard ceilings on time, memory, and call depth. Reviewers should confirm any change to these ceilings is justified in the PR description, since raising them widens the abuse surface. Defaults were chosen from production traces. The current limits are as follows.

limits module of tafog-fawip:
WEIGHTS = {
    "julix": 57,
    "lamys": 992,
    "kasvan": 209,
    "quenok": 750,
    "alddor": 259,
    "oliath": 1009,
    "wenix": 815,
}

### Step 3: Switch to the new `tailgate` CLI

The old `logpeek` tool is gone. Use `tailgate` for all log tailing; it authenticates via your session token and streams from the aggregator directly. Flags changed: `-f` is now default, `--since` takes durations only. If a stream stalls mid-incident, restart with `--resume`. No local log files exist anymore. The CLI reads its connection settings from the block below.

deployment values, taweg-bajop:
[fenvan]
port = 5672
team = holmir
host = fenvan.orvexio.example
region = lower-1
access_code = ac_b98bc6
timeout_ms = 1500

Runbook: StormRelay fan-out, security review notes. When the Galeport ingest node receives a severe-weather bulletin, StormRelay fans it out to regional notifier queues within two seconds. Each queue worker authenticates independently; messages are signed at ingest and verified at delivery. Dead-lettered alerts retry three times, then page the on-call. Audit logs are retained for ninety days in Coldvault. To inspect fan-out behavior in the staging environment, authenticate to the internal relay API with the key below.

app token of yajeg-kawef = kto11_7En3XSX8xQw